A T-SQL code formatter driven by RedGate-compatible style configurations. Provides fine-grained control over whitespace, casing, parentheses, lists, joins, CTEs, CASE expressions, operators, and more through JSON configuration files.
npm install
npm run buildNo runtime dependencies -- only TypeScript, @types/node, and Vitest for development.
# Format a file with a style config
sql-format --style style.json input.sql
# Format using default settings
sql-format input.sql
# Read from stdin
cat input.sql | sql-format --style style.json
# Overwrite the file in place
sql-format --style style.json -i input.sql| Flag | Short | Argument | Description |

The formatter uses a three-stage pipeline:
SQL Text --> Tokenizer --> Parser --> Formatter --> Formatted SQL
(lexer) (AST) (printer)
-
Tokenizer (
src/tokenizer.ts) -- Splits SQL text into tokens (keywords, identifiers, strings, operators, comments, etc.). HandlesGObatch separator detection, nested block comments, and UTF encoding. -
Parser (
src/parser.ts) -- Recursive descent parser that builds an AST from the token stream. Handles operator precedence, multi-word constructs (GROUP BY,IS NOT NULL), subqueries, and all T-SQL statement types. -
Formatter (
src/formatter.ts) -- Walks the AST and produces formatted output according to the configuration. Supports smart collapsing (short statements stay on one line), alias alignment, comment preservation, and line wrapping.
Input:
select a.id, a.name, b.value from dbo.table1 a inner join dbo.table2 b on a.id = b.id where a.active = 1 and b.value > 100 order by a.nameOutput (with defaults):
SELECT
a.id,
a.name,
b.value
FROM
dbo.table1 a
INNER JOIN dbo.table2 b
ON a.id = b.id
WHERE
a.active = 1
AND b.value > 100
ORDER BY
